Infosys Founder Narayana Murthy Visits GIFT City
June 27, 2025
Gandhinagar: Infosys founder N.R. Narayana Murthy visited Gujarat International Finance Tec-City (GIFT City) on Friday. During his visit, he held a detailed meeting with Dr. Hasmukh Adhia, Chairman of GIFT City, Tapan Ray, Managing Director and Group CEO of GIFT City; and K. Rajaraman, Chairman of the International Financial Services Centres Authority (IFSCA), said an official statement.
Murthy was briefed on the wide range of initiatives and developments currently underway at GIFT City. He lauded the rapid progress being made and expressed appreciation for the world-class infrastructure and the growing number of international companies establishing operations in GIFT City. He noted that such developments are critical to positioning GIFT City as a global hub for financial and technology services, as well as fintech innovation, the release stated.
As per the official statement, Murthy also shared insightful suggestions on further strengthening the overall ecosystem. He emphasized the need to create an environment that fosters innovation, and deepening collaboration between academia and industry to support GIFT City’s long-term growth as a fintech powerhouse.
As part of his visit, Murthy also interacted with students of Jamnabai Narsee School, Deakin University, and the University of Wollongong at GIFT City. He encouraged them to dream big, work hard, and strive for excellence in all their pursuits, inspiring the next generation of leaders and innovators.
Notably, Infosys has set up a new development centre at GIFT City which was inaugurated on June 7 this year. This center will offer a state-of-the-art facility for over 1,000 employees in a hybrid working model. It will function as a key TechFin hub, delivering advanced digital solutions for global BFSI clients. Its services will span critical domains including digital banking, regulatory affairs, trade finance, capital markets, cards & payments, as well as risk & compliance management. DeshGujarat
